siaz是数据库的什么

fiy 其他 9

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Siaz是一个开源的分布式数据库系统。它是由一群热爱技术的工程师团队开发的,旨在为用户提供高性能、高可用性和可扩展性的数据库解决方案。

    以下是关于Siaz数据库的五个要点:

    1. 分布式架构:Siaz数据库采用分布式架构,可以将数据分布到多个节点上进行存储和处理。这种架构可以提高系统的性能和可扩展性,使得数据库能够处理大规模的数据和高并发访问。

    2. 高可用性:Siaz数据库具有高可用性的特点,它使用了主从复制和故障转移机制来保证系统的稳定性和可靠性。当主节点出现故障时,系统会自动切换到备用节点,从而避免了数据丢失和服务中断。

    3. 强一致性:Siaz数据库采用了强一致性模型,即对于所有的读写操作,系统保证所有的节点都能看到最新的数据。这种模型可以保证数据的一致性,但可能会影响系统的性能。

    4. 支持多种数据模型:Siaz数据库支持多种数据模型,包括关系型数据模型和文档型数据模型。用户可以根据自己的需求选择合适的数据模型来存储和查询数据。

    5. 开源社区支持:Siaz是一个开源项目,拥有一个活跃的开源社区。用户可以通过社区获得技术支持、交流经验和参与开发。开源社区的支持使得Siaz数据库能够不断地进行改进和优化,以满足不同用户的需求。

    总之,Siaz是一个分布式数据库系统,具有高性能、高可用性和可扩展性的特点,支持多种数据模型,并且拥有一个活跃的开源社区。对于需要处理大规模数据和高并发访问的应用场景,Siaz数据库是一个值得考虑的选择。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Siaz是一种数据库管理系统(DBMS),它是一个开源的、分布式的关系型数据库。Siaz的设计目标是提供高性能、高可用性和可扩展性的数据库解决方案。

    Siaz采用了分布式架构,可以在多台机器上进行部署和运行。它使用了分布式哈希表(DHT)来管理数据的分布和访问,这使得数据可以在不同的节点上进行存储和处理,提高了系统的容错性和负载均衡能力。

    Siaz支持SQL语言,并提供了一系列的API和工具,方便开发人员进行数据的操作和管理。它支持事务处理和并发控制,保证数据的一致性和完整性。同时,Siaz还提供了数据备份和恢复的功能,以保证数据的安全性。

    Siaz具有良好的扩展性,可以根据实际需求进行水平扩展。通过添加新的节点,可以增加系统的存储容量和处理能力,而不需要对现有的数据进行迁移和重建。

    总之,Siaz是一种分布式的关系型数据库管理系统,它具有高性能、高可用性和可扩展性的特点,可以满足大规模数据存储和处理的需求。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    SIAZ是一个基于Rust编写的分布式数据库系统。它的设计目标是在高并发和大规模数据处理场景下提供高性能和可扩展性。

    SIAZ的特点包括以下几个方面:

    1. 分布式架构:SIAZ采用分布式架构,可以将数据分布在多个节点上进行存储和处理。这样可以提高系统的并发处理能力和数据的可靠性。

    2. 高性能:SIAZ使用了多种优化技术来提高系统的性能。例如,它采用了基于内存的存储引擎,可以快速地读写数据。此外,SIAZ还支持数据的分区和并行处理,可以充分利用多核处理器的计算能力。

    3. 可扩展性:SIAZ可以根据需要动态地扩展节点和存储容量。它采用了分布式哈希表(DHT)算法来管理节点和数据的分布,可以自动地将数据分配到不同的节点上。这样可以实现系统的水平扩展,提供更大的存储容量和更高的并发处理能力。

    4. 容错性:SIAZ通过数据的冗余备份和分布式事务来提高系统的容错性。它可以将数据复制到多个节点上,以防止单点故障。此外,SIAZ还支持分布式事务,可以保证数据的一致性和可靠性。

    5. 灵活性:SIAZ支持多种数据模型和查询语言。它可以存储结构化数据、半结构化数据和非结构化数据,并提供了类似SQL的查询语言和基于图的查询语言。这样可以满足不同应用场景的需求。

    下面是SIAZ的操作流程:

    1. 安装和配置:首先,需要下载并安装SIAZ的软件包。然后,根据系统的需求进行配置,包括节点的数量、存储容量、网络配置等。

    2. 创建数据库:在SIAZ中,可以创建多个数据库实例,每个实例对应一个独立的数据集。可以使用SIAZ的管理工具来创建数据库实例,并指定数据模型和存储引擎。

    3. 数据存储:在SIAZ中,数据被分为多个分区,并存储在不同的节点上。可以使用SIAZ的API或命令行工具来插入、更新和删除数据。

    4. 数据查询:可以使用SIAZ的查询语言来查询数据。SIAZ支持类似SQL的查询语言和基于图的查询语言。可以根据需要编写查询语句,并指定查询的条件和排序方式。

    5. 数据备份和恢复:为了保证数据的可靠性,可以定期进行数据备份。SIAZ提供了备份和恢复的工具,可以将数据备份到本地磁盘或远程存储。

    6. 系统监控和调优:可以使用SIAZ的监控工具来监视系统的运行状态和性能指标。可以根据监控结果进行系统调优,以提高系统的性能和可靠性。

    总之,SIAZ是一个高性能、可扩展和容错的分布式数据库系统。它采用分布式架构和优化技术,可以在高并发和大规模数据处理场景下提供稳定和可靠的数据存储和查询服务。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部